charset="utf-8" Currently many users transitioned already to the new introduced workqueue (system_percpu_wq, system_dfl_wq), but there are new users who still use the older system_wq and system_unbound_wq. This change try to push this transition forward, by warning whether the old workqueus are used. charset="utf-8" Currently there are no checks in order to enforce the use of WQ_PERCPU and avoid this flag is used if WQ_UNBOUND is already present. So act as following: - if neither of them is present, set WQ_PERCPU - if both are present, remove WQ_PERCPU Along with this change, print a warning, so that the code still uses both or neither of them, can be changed.
